Transaction 9573ae7b412d91b4828f48e9add80deb7410fe56e625f96e2225048fea7bcd02

1 Input
2 Outputs
  • 9573ae7b412d91b4828f48e9add80deb7410fe56e625f96e2225048fea7bcd02:0
  • value  270168044
    address  124G5hbLA3WypWYsgjZEWGmtkxCyKGGRoR
  • 9573ae7b412d91b4828f48e9add80deb7410fe56e625f96e2225048fea7bcd02:1
  • value  1561086
    address  1PjcwEma73RqokPqSZhZMB5bRAS1re184w